Hi guys, I wrote my G1 Exit (to get G2) in Kingston and passed. There is some repairs ongoing on princess street. As a result, there is a new route examiners following these day. For those yet to write, may use it to get familiar.

From the Drive test Centre, you will exit from the farther side of the parking lot. You will follow this route from either side.

- Right on the select drive
- Left on to Futures gate
- From the Signal, you will proceed to Augusta drive
- Once on the Augusta drive, you will take left on Langfield street
- From the stop sign, you will take right towards Emerald street
- Left on to Crossfield Ave
- Left toward Centennial Drive
- Left towards Princess St
- Right towards Future gate
- Left for Select Drive
- Immediate right to enter the parking lot.

In the parking lot, you will be doing front parking. All other maneuvers, you will do on Augusta Dr and Langfield st.

These may vary a bit based on Examiner.

Alexo wrote: Anyone has the Mount Joy route?
From my friends kid who just passed.

Right on Bur Oak,
left on Williamson, continuing past Castlemore .
Turn on a side street (forgot which one she said)
Parallel parking and simulated Uphill parking.
3 point turn back down to Castlemore
Left on Markham Rd
Left back to Mount Joy.

About 8-10 mins in total.
